The opening day of the CAFA Nations Cup continues with a pivotal group stage clash between Tajikistan and India, set for Friday, August 29 at 17:30 CET. Both teams come into the match with points to prove, but it’s the Tajik side that looks better positioned for success.
Match Preview
Tajikistan had a tough outing in the previous edition of the CAFA Nations Cup, failing to win a single group stage game in a group featuring Uzbekistan, Oman, and Turkmenistan. However, recent performances suggest a team rebuilding with some momentum. A 2-1 win over Cambodia and a 2-2 draw with the Philippines have shown improvements in their attacking fluidity, with goals coming from different areas of the pitch.
What stands out for Tajikistan is their consistency in finding the net. They’ve scored in three straight matches and seem more confident in forward play. Defensively, questions remain, but in this matchup, they’re likely to see more of the ball and dictate tempo.
India, making their debut in the CAFA Nations Cup, arrive with a mixed bag of recent results. While they’ve suffered just one defeat in their last 10 matches, the number of draws and goalless outings is a concern. Three consecutive matches without scoring, including losses to Thailand (0-2) and Hong Kong (0-1) in June, underscore the current lack of cutting edge in attack.
India’s midfield struggles to connect with the forward line, and their defensive shape—while compact—often invites too much pressure. Unless there’s a marked improvement in build-up play and finishing, they could struggle to keep pace with Tajikistan’s energy and directness.
Tajikistan vs India Head-to-Head (Key Match Facts)
-
Tajikistan have lost just once in their last five matches
-
India have only one win in their previous 10 games
-
India have failed to score in their last three matches
-
Tajikistan have scored in each of their last three outings
-
Last H2H meeting: Tajikistan beat India 4-2 (2019)
